Hi Gaurav, Santro is no doubt a great car but the limitations are a bumpy ride as compared to the Ritz. The Ritz has a rear 60:40 folding seat so additional space can be made even while seating a 3rd person in the car so this is ideal for a family with a single child. If you are single and this is... your first car then the Ritz is more value for money on the long run and you can consider your additional 40K as an investment becasue you may not feel the need to upgrade to your next car earlier you can just stretch this for a little while longer. But ofcourse the Lxi will come without the frills of power windows etc. Ofcourse the Central Locking can be fit later but If these are more important then you have to weigh the options.Read More
